From 0de8b2189086a7c2c4253996c3f2f2b9ec28677e Mon Sep 17 00:00:00 2001 From: Rein Klazes Date: Tue, 21 Oct 2003 23:49:03 +0000 Subject: [PATCH] A WM_CREATE message sent to an Edit window procedure should return 1. Power Builder masked edit controls depend on it. --- controls/edit.c |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/controls/edit.c b/controls/edit.c index 3a0945356e6..9370807b3b1 100644 --- a/controls/edit.c +++ b/controls/edit.c @@ -3780,7 +3780,11 @@ static LRESULT EDIT_WM_Create(EDITSTATE *es, LPCWSTR name) } /* force scroll info update */ EDIT_UpdateScrollInfo(es); - return 0; + /* The rule seems to return 1 here for success */ + /* Power Builder masked edit controls will crash */ + /* if not. */ + /* FIXME: is that in all cases so ? */ + return 1; }